<h3 id="grasping-authorized-agents" id="grasping-authorized-agents">Grasping Authorized Agents</h3>

<p>Designated agents play as a crucial part in the creation and continuing functioning of companies. They function as the designated channel of contact for obtaining judicial papers, state documents, and additional important messages on behalf of a commercial firm. This guarantees that firms remain adhering with state regulations and maintain favorable standing. By using a registered agent, companies can also guarantee discretion, as the designated agent&#39;s address is published openly instead of the firm owner&#39;s home details.</p>

<p>One of the main roles of a authorized representative is to function as an representative for delivery of notice. This means that when a legal action is brought against a firm, the designated representative collects the law-related documents and is obliged to forwarding them to the appropriate parties within the company. This dependable support aids firms respond quickly to judicial issues, hence reducing possible dangers related to overlooked due dates or unresolved law-related concerns.</p>

<h3 id="requirements-and-costs-of-a-registered-agent" id="requirements-and-costs-of-a-registered-agent">Requirements and Costs of a Registered Agent</h3>

<p>Launching a business, understanding the registered agent requirements is crucial. Each state in the United States imposes specific laws that dictate the eligibility for registered agents. In most cases, a registered agent must be a resident of the state where the business is formed or a business entity registered and permitted to operate in the state. The registered agent’s main duty is to accept crucial legal documents and government notifications for the business. This ensures that the business can be reliably reached for legal matters, compliance filings, and service of process.</p>

<p>The cost of registered agent services can vary significantly depending on the provider and the services included. On average, businesses can budget between $100 and $300 yearly for dependable registered agent services.
